📖 Before I Let Go by Kennedy Ryan
🕯️ Cocoa Cashmere (Candle)
Why this pairing works:

Kennedy Ryan’s Before I Let Go is an emotional, tender, and deeply moving second-chance romance about love after loss, growth, co-parenting, and finding your way back to someone—and yourself. It’s heavy with vulnerability but wrapped in so much warmth, maturity, and healing.
Lighting this candle while reading brings a feeling of wrapping yourself in a warm embrace—exactly what this book delivers as you navigate Yasmen and Josiah’s complex, but beautiful, love story.

📖 The Water Dancer by Ta-Nehisi Coates
Wax Melt: Monumental Dreams
Why this pairing works:

The Water Dancer is a powerful blend of historical fiction and magical realism—a story that transports readers through memory, legacy, and liberation. It’s rich with emotion, vivid imagery, and a deep sense of ancestral purpose. Monumental in its message, poetic in its execution.
This pairing is about more than ambiance — With its grounding yet uplifting fragrance notes, it evokes strength, clarity, and inner vision—just like Hiram’s journey of remembering and reclaiming. As your space fills with its scent, let it set the tone for reflection, reverence, and imagination.
it’s a sensory extension of the book’s spiritual depth and emotional gravity.
